Overview
Williams Mullen is seeking an experienced commercial real estate paralegal to join our Raleigh, North Carolina office.
Responsibilities- Highly accomplished, paralegal (legal) professional with in-depth knowledge and experience in commercial real estate transactions, with strong organizational, communication, interpersonal and multitasking skills.
- Ability to abstract and search real estate titles and analyze title exception documents for potential issues.
- Organize and assemble documents for closings and large commercial loans.
- Draft, analyze and review real estate documents, including deeds, deeds of trust, settlement statements, UCC's, title commitments, title exceptions, surveys, zoning letters and reports, environmental reports, lien releases, memoranda of leases, ancillary lease documents and client correspondence.
- Interface with lenders, borrowers, clients, appraisers, surveyors, insurance companies, zoning authorities, local governments, title abstract and title insurance companies, taxing authorities, attorneys, court personnel, and others, in connection with obtaining all necessary information for commercial real estate transactions.
- File zoning applications and other documents with local governments.
- Maintain and organize electronic and hard copies of transaction and due diligence documents.
- Bachelor's Degree and/or related paralegal certificate required
- 3+ years of Paralegal experience in managing commercial real estate matters from contract to closing and working in law firm environment
- Excellent verbal and written communication skills
- Strong organizational skills and attention to detail
- Knowledge of iManage/File Site or comparable document sharing programs
- Knowledge of Aderant/iTimekeep or comparable time keeping program
